Poetry Parnassus: Continental Shift: Simon Armitage, Kim Hyesoon, , Seamus Heaney, Bill Manhire, Kay Ryan, Jo Shapcott, Wole Soyinka
Six world poets from six continents read with Jo Shapcott and Poetry Parnassus curator, Simon Armitage.
Wole Soyinka (Nigeria), Kay Ryan (USA), Seamus Heaney (Ireland), Kim Hyesoon (South Korea), Claribel Algeria (Nicaragua) and Bill Manhire (New Zealand) all take to the stage for an evening which includes two Poet Laureates, two Nobel Laureates and a Gold Medallist.
The readings are in English, Korean and Spanish

Simon Armitage
The Millennium poet, who has published numerous collections of poetry, produced several novels, and written extensively for television and radio. In 2010 he received the CBE for services to poetry.

Wole Soyinka
Nigerian playwright, poet, novelist and critic, Soyinka was the first African to be awarded the Nobel Prize for Literature. He has been imprisoned several times for his criticism of the Nigerian government and has been living for long periods in exile since the 1970s.
